For starters, regulation is tightening across major markets. Countries like the UK, Germany, and parts of the US are demanding stricter licensing, responsible gambling tools, and transparent RTP reporting. That means fewer shady operators and a safer environment for everyone. But it also means new features are popping up that make the experience feel more personalized and immersive.

Crypto and Instant Withdrawals Become Standard

Waiting three days for a withdrawal is old news. The future is instant payouts, and crypto is the main driver. Bitcoin, Ethereum, and stablecoins like USDT are now accepted on most modern betting platforms. No more bank delays or conversion fees.

But it’s not just about speed. Blockchain tech also brings provably fair gaming. You can actually verify that each spin or hand was random. That level of transparency is a game-changer for trust. VR and AR Aren’t Hype—They’re Coming

Virtual reality casinos have been a niche experiment, but that’s shifting. Headsets like the Meta Quest 3 are getting cheaper and more comfortable. Developers are building full 3D casino floors where you can walk around, sit at a blackjack table, or spin a slot machine in a virtual penthouse.

Augmented reality is sneakier. Imagine pointing your phone at your coffee table and seeing a slot reels appear on it. That’s already being tested. The tech isn’t perfect yet, but within a couple of years, we’ll see it integrated into mobile apps. You won’t need a headset—your phone will handle the magic.

Responsible Gambling Tools Get Smarter

We can’t ignore the elephant in the room—problem gambling is a real issue. The future isn’t just about flashy features; it’s about safety. New tools let you set hard limits on deposits, session times, and losses before you even start playing. Some casinos even use AI to detect risky patterns, like chasing losses or playing for hours straight.

These systems send gentle nudges or auto-lock your account for a cooldown. It’s not about banning fun—it’s about keeping it fun.
